Understanding Lean

Lean is a recreational drug concoction that has gained popularity, particularly in certain music and youth cultures. Understanding its origins, ingredients, and preparation methods is essential to grasp what is entailed in this substance.

Origins and Popularity

The origins of lean can be traced back to the Southern United States, where it has been primarily associated with hip-hop culture. The drink became widely recognized in the 1990s, with various artists referencing it in their music. Lean is often referred to by other names, such as "Purple Drank," which emphasizes the purple color of the popular cough syrup used in its preparation.

As lean gained popularity, its consumption spread beyond musical references and became a lifestyle choice in some circles, particularly among younger audiences. This rise in popularity also led to an increase in misuse and addiction, which poses serious health risks, such as respiratory depression and cardiac complications (Wikipedia).

Ingredients and Preparation

The typical preparation of lean involves mixing prescription-grade cough syrup that contains both promethazine and codeine with a carbonated soft drink, often Sprite, Mountain Dew, or Fanta. The drink is typically served in two foam cups and is sometimes sweetened with hard candy, such as a Jolly Rancher, to enhance its flavor (Wikipedia).

Here’s a breakdown of the main ingredients:

IngredientDescriptionCough SyrupContains codeine (opioid) and promethazine (antihistamine)Soft DrinkTypically Sprite, Mountain Dew, or FantaHard CandyUsually Jolly Rancher for added sweetness

Lean, especially when combined with alcohol, is regarded as highly dangerous. Users may face serious complications including addiction, respiratory arrest, and other life-threatening conditions (Wikipedia).

Notable Cases and Consequences

Celebrity Incidents

Lean, also known as Dirty Sprite, has been linked to several tragic incidents involving celebrities. The drug gained popularity in the 1990s, particularly through music culture, and has since seen notable figures fall victim to its effects. High-profile cases include the deaths of artists like DJ Screw, Big Moe, Pimp C, and Fredo Santana. These individuals are often remembered for their musical contributions while their struggles with Lean addiction highlight the dangers associated with its consumption.

In addition to these fatalities, several athletes and celebrities have faced legal issues related to Lean use. Notable incidents include the arrests of NFL players Terrence Kiel and Johnny Jolly, as well as musicians JaMarcus Russell and 2 Chainz. These cases underscore the pervasive nature of this addiction within the entertainment industry. The forces that drive their substance use often reveal underlying psychological dependencies linked to their careers and lifestyles.

Legal Implications

The consumption of Lean, which contains codeine—a Schedule II drug—holds significant legal ramifications. Unauthorized possession or consumption of codeine, especially in the quantities typically found in Lean, can lead to serious consequences, including hefty fines and potential incarceration. Issues related to driving under the influence while intoxicated by Lean further exacerbate the legal risks.

OffensePossible ConsequencesUnauthorized possession of codeineFines and imprisonmentDriving under the influence (DUI)License suspension, fines, legal feesDistribution of LeanIncreased penalties, felony charges

Dangers and Risks

Understanding the dangers associated with Dirty Sprite, also known as Lean, is crucial for anyone considering its use. The combination of ingredients in this drink can lead to significant health risks and a potential for addiction.

Health Risks

Dirty Sprite contains codeine, an opioid that poses several health risks. Consuming Lean can cause respiratory depression, where breathing becomes shallower and less effective. This can escalate to more severe complications such as respiratory arrest or cardiac arrest (Wikipedia). Other health issues linked to this drink include:

Health RiskDescriptionRespiratory DepressionSlowed breathing, which can lead to life-threatening situations.NauseaCommon side effect that can occur with opioid use.ConstipationOften experienced by those using opioids.Liver and Kidney DamageDue to the combination of substances and potential overuse.Hormonal ImbalanceCan affect various bodily functions and systems.Sexual DysfunctionImpacts sexual health and performance.Weakened Immune SystemIncreased vulnerability to infections and illnesses.

In addition to these risks, users of Dirty Sprite are also more likely to engage in risky behaviors due to impaired judgment and coordination.

Addiction Potential

The potential for addiction to Dirty Sprite is significant, often emerging rapidly due to the brain's response to the opioids present. Codeine triggers the brain's reward system, leading to the release of dopamine, which is associated with pleasure. This creates a temporary feeling of euphoria that many users seek to replicate [3]. The addiction process can be broken down as follows:

Type of DependenceDescriptionPhysical DependenceUsers may experience withdrawal symptoms when not using Lean, making it difficult to stop using the substance.Psychological DependenceMany users rely on the drink to cope with negative emotions or to feel 'normal,' creating a cycle of continued use despite adverse consequences.

Dirty Sprite's euphoric effects, driven by its opioid content, can lead individuals to consume the drink regularly, worsening their dependence. Lean vs. Dirty Sodas

Origins and Popularity

Lean, often referred to as "dirty Sprite," originated in the Southern United States, especially within the hip-hop culture. The drink typically combines prescription cough syrup containing codeine and promethazine with soft drinks, most notably Sprite. It has become popularized in various rap songs and social media, leading to a cultural phenomenon that glamorizes its use.

In contrast, dirty sodas are a recent trend that has gained traction in the past few years, particularly in Utah. This mixed drink combines soft drinks with flavor add-ins like cream, flavored syrups, and sweeteners. Popular combinations include Dr Pepper with coconut creamer and Diet Coke with protein milk. The surge in dirty soda's popularity has been further propelled by social media and reality shows such as "The Secret Lives of Mormon Wives," which showcased the popular Utah-based dirty soda shop "Swig" [6].

Drink TypeOriginPopularity SourceLean (Dirty Sprite)Southern USAHip-hop cultureDirty SodasUtahSocial media & reality shows

Health Implications

The health implications of lean consumption and dirty sodas vary significantly. Lean contains codeine, an opiate that can lead to serious health risks, including respiratory issues, addiction, and overdose. Continuous use can result in both physical and psychological dependence, impacting overall health negatively. For more on these effects, including dangerous opiate abuse side effects, check here.

In contrast, dirty sodas, while not typically dangerous in the short term, are characterized by their high calorie content and lack of nutritional value. These beverages are likened to occasional treats similar to cake or sugary coffee drinks. They often contribute to calorie deficiencies and health concerns if they replace actual meals [6]. Overconsumption can lead to issues like obesity and metabolic problems, especially if incorporated regularly into one’s diet.
